Food Labelling Laws

Part of Oral Answers to Questions — Environment, Food and Rural Affairs – in the House of Commons on 21 February 2019.

The UK has world-leading standards of food information, backed by a rigorous legislative framework, but the Secretary of State has been clear that an overhaul of allergen labelling is needed and DEFRA is working with other Departments to deliver that. We are also committed to reviewing food labelling laws after EU exit, so that consumers’ confidence in the food they buy continues to grow.
